Category: DessertsCuisine: Europe, GermanTotal Time: 1 hr 5 mins1. In a small bowl, combine flour, confectioners' sugar and salt.
2. Cut in butter to form a dough. Pat lightly into an ungreased 11x7-in. baking pan. , Arrange peaches over the crust; set aside.
3. In another bowl, beat eggs. Whisk in the sugar, salt, flour and sour cream until mixture is smooth.
4. Pour over the peaches. , Bake at 450° for 10 minutes.

How do you make peaches with carbquick?

Preheat oven to 350 degrees and slice peaches. You can leave the skin on or peel them. In a bowl, mix together Carbquick, almond milk, nutmeg and cinnamon. Melt butter and pour into the bottom of a 8x8 in baking dish. Spoon the Carbquick mix over the top and spread out evenly but do not mix. Let the butter pool around the edges.

What size peaches do you use to make peaches bars?

They should be no larger than the size of your pinky nail or standard-sized chocolate chips. This smaller size ensures your bars bake evenly and that you have a thin, even layer of peaches spread all the way across the crust. Both fresh peaches and peaches canned in 100% juice will work.
